Optimal Period
A specific timeframe in which certain experiences have a more profound effect on development or learning than at other times.
Separation Anxiety
A disorder characterized by excessive fear or anxiety about separation from home or an attachment figure.
Emotional Distress
A state of emotional suffering typically triggered by stressful situations, characterized by feelings of anxiety, depression, or trauma.
Adult Caregiver
An individual, typically an adult, who provides care for another person who is unable to care for themselves due to illness, disability, or age.
